Designed for multi-discipline riders seeking comfort, versatility and performance in one saddle, the Dimension NDR brings off-road capability to modern bike positioning.

Why youll appreciate it

  • Enhanced cushioning: features 3 mm extra padding across the surface compared to traditional models, offering extra comfort for longer rides.

  • Compact design: the snub-nose is approximately 35 mm shorter than traditional saddles, distributing pressure more evenly and empowering modern, aerodynamic positions.

  • Ergonomic shape: the rounded profile supports natural pelvic rotation, improving contact consistency and reducing hotspots.

  • Advanced channel: a wider PAS (Perineal Area System) channel reduces soft-tissue compression, helping maintain blood flow and minimise numbness during extended efforts.

  • Durable build: side-protectors on the saddle shell help guard against scratches and rips, making it robust enough for mixed terrain use.

  • Smart dimensions: available in a 245 143 mm size and weighs approximately 229 g with the T4.0 rail, providing a balanced mix of light weight and comfort.

Pro tip for installation
Start with a neutral saddle tilt and your most recent fore-aft setting. After installation, test on a mixed ride including seated efforts and climbs. If you notice pressure towards the front or excessive movement, experiment with small tilt adjustments (2-3 mm) rather than major position changes. Bedding in the saddle across two or three sessions will ensure you get the ride feel dialled before major events.
